Uuvm kein zugriff mehr

Hallo,

Logge ich mich im umc ein, wähle UUVM aus, so erhälte ich endlos die Meldung:

Das Skript “/usr/lib/univention-virtual-machine-manager-daemon/uvmmd-check.sh” meldet bei JEDEM aufruf:

Was tun?

lG

Hallo,

gibt es Fehlermeldungen in den zugehörigen Logdateien (/var/log/univention/virtual-machine-manager-daemon*.log) und/oder beim manuellen Restart von UVMM? Welche UCS Version ist auf dem UVMM System und den Virtualisierungsservern im Einsatz? Wie viele Virtualisierungsserver sind angeschlossen?

Mit freundlichen Grüßen
Janis Meybohm

Problem tritt immer noch ab und zu auf, nur habe ich keine Fehlermeldungen…

Ich kann nur soviel sagen, dass dann minütlich der uuvm vom Skript “/usr/lib/univention-virtual-machine-manager-daemon/uvmmd-check.sh” neu gestartet wird…

Das einzige, was bis jetzt immer hilft, ist ein System Reboot…

Hallo,

um das Problem beurteilen zu können, würde ich Sie um die im letzten Post angefragten Informationen bitten. Außerdem können Sie, wenn das Problem das nächste mal auftritt, evtl. mit dem folgenden Befehl einige weitere Informationen sammeln:

strace -ttT -f -p $(pgrep -f /usr/sbin/univention-virtual-machine-manager-daemon)

Mit freundlichen Grüßen
Janis Meybohm

Hallo,

und schon wieder dieses Problem…!!!

virtual-machine-manager-log schreibt seit dem Zeitpunkt, seitdem er nicht funktioniert, auch nichts mehr!

root@mastersrv:~# cat /etc/issue Univention DC Master 2.4-3-6
Mit virsh kann ich weiterhin Maschinen starten & stoppen.

strace spricht:

Process 5749 attached with 4 threads - interrupt to quit [pid 5749] 14:42:05.866871 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.867063 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, <unfinished ...> [pid 5748] 14:42:05.867234 futex(0x7fdbd75cb9e0, FUTEX_WAIT_PRIVATE, 2, NULL <unfinished ...> [pid 5749] 14:42:05.867257 <... rt_sigaction resumed> {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000061> [pid 5732] 14:42:05.867276 futex(0x1e52870, FUTEX_WAIT_PRIVATE, 2, NULL <unfinished ...> [pid 5730] 14:42:05.867317 futex(0xfb3430, FUTEX_WAIT_PRIVATE, 0, NULL <unfinished ...> [pid 5749] 14:42:05.867330 rt_sigreturn(0xb) = 31651264 <0.000022> [pid 5749] 14:42:05.867395 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.867466 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000014> [pid 5749] 14:42:05.867526 rt_sigreturn(0xb) = 31651264 <0.000012> [pid 5749] 14:42:05.867571 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.867626 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000013> [pid 5749] 14:42:05.867682 rt_sigreturn(0xb) = 31651264 <0.000012> [pid 5749] 14:42:05.867722 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.867777 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000013> [pid 5749] 14:42:05.867830 rt_sigreturn(0xb) = 31651264 <0.000012> [pid 5749] 14:42:05.867873 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.867927 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000013> [pid 5749] 14:42:05.867981 rt_sigreturn(0xb) = 31651264 <0.000025> [pid 5749] 14:42:05.868046 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.868149 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000014> [pid 5749] 14:42:05.868205 rt_sigreturn(0xb) = 31651264 <0.000013> [pid 5749] 14:42:05.868246 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.868308 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000008> [pid 5749] 14:42:05.868360 rt_sigreturn(0xb) = 31651264 <0.000013> [pid 5749] 14:42:05.868403 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.868456 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000010> [pid 5749] 14:42:05.868501 rt_sigreturn(0xb) = 31651264 <0.000013> [pid 5749] 14:42:05.868543 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.868595 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000009> [pid 5749] 14:42:05.868645 rt_sigreturn(0xb) = 31651264 <0.000013> [pid 5749] 14:42:05.868688 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.868740 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000010> [pid 5749] 14:42:05.868789 rt_sigreturn(0xb) = 31651264 <0.000013> [pid 5749] 14:42:05.868832 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.868884 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000010> [pid 5749] 14:42:05.868934 rt_sigreturn(0xb) = 31651264 <0.000013> [pid 5749] 14:42:05.868977 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.869039 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000011> [pid 5749] 14:42:05.869139 rt_sigreturn(0xb) = 31651264 <0.000012> [pid 5749] 14:42:05.869182 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.869234 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000022> [pid 5749] 14:42:05.869313 rt_sigreturn(0xb) = 31651264 <0.000013> [pid 5749] 14:42:05.869357 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.869408 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000009> [pid 5749] 14:42:05.869457 rt_sigreturn(0xb) = 31651264 <0.000011> [pid 5749] 14:42:05.869495 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.869548 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000008> [pid 5749] 14:42:05.869595 rt_sigreturn(0xb) = 31651264 <0.000013> [pid 5749] 14:42:05.869636 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.869689 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000008> [pid 5749] 14:42:05.869736 rt_sigreturn(0xb) = 31651264 <0.000010> [pid 5749] 14:42:05.869775 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.869826 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000010> [pid 5749] 14:42:05.869876 rt_sigreturn(0xb) = 31651264 <0.000011> [pid 5749] 14:42:05.869914 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.869966 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000033> [pid 5749] 14:42:05.870043 rt_sigreturn(0xb) = 31651264 <0.000011> [pid 5749] 14:42:05.870135 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.870187 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000012> [pid 5749] 14:42:05.870236 rt_sigreturn(0xb) = 31651264 <0.000014> [pid 5749] 14:42:05.870280 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.870338 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000009> [pid 5749] 14:42:05.870384 rt_sigreturn(0xb) = 31651264 <0.000009> [pid 5749] 14:42:05.870418 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.870468 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000009> [pid 5749] 14:42:05.870512 rt_sigreturn(0xb) = 31651264 <0.000009> [pid 5749] 14:42:05.870546 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.870594 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000010> [pid 5749] 14:42:05.870645 rt_sigreturn(0xb) = 31651264 <0.000009> [pid 5749] 14:42:05.870680 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.870729 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000009> [pid 5749] 14:42:05.870774 rt_sigreturn(0xb) = 31651264 <0.000009> [pid 5749] 14:42:05.870807 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.870855 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000009> [pid 5749] 14:42:05.870899 rt_sigreturn(0xb) = 31651264 <0.000009> [pid 5749] 14:42:05.870933 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.870981 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000017> [pid 5749] 14:42:05.871041 rt_sigreturn(0xb) = 31651264 <0.000009> [pid 5749] 14:42:05.871132 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.871182 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000010> [pid 5749] 14:42:05.871227 rt_sigreturn(0xb) = 31651264 <0.000009> [pid 5749] 14:42:05.871280 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.871347 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000011> [pid 5749] 14:42:05.871397 rt_sigreturn(0xb) = 31651264 <0.000011> [pid 5749] 14:42:05.871432 --- SIGSEGV (Segmentation fault) @ 0 (0) --- [pid 5749] 14:42:05.871482 rt_sigaction(SIGSEGV,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, {0x4aec30, [], SA_RESTORER, 0x7fdbd7c68a80}, 8) = 0 <0.000008> [pid 5749] 14:42:05.871527 rt_sigreturn(0xb) = 31651264 <0.000009> [pid 5749] 14:42:05.871562 --- SIGSEGV (Segmentation fault) @ 0 (0) ---

Die Ausgabe erfolgt endlos lange, bis ich den Prozess abbreche…

Hallo,

das Problem hier ist der Segmentation fault der auf ein Problem im Python Interpreter und/oder eines der C-Bindings hindeutet.
Um hier nähere Informationen über die Ursache zu bekommen, müsste ich Sie bitten, mittels GDB Backtraces des UVMMd im defekten Zustand zu erzeugen und an uns zu senden.
Hierzu sollte das System wie folgt vorbereitet werden:

[ul]
[li] Installation von Debug-Pakete auf dem betroffenen System (diese können nach dem Erzeugen des Backtrace wieder entfernt werden):

oldstate=$(ucr get repository/online/unmaintained) ucr set repository/online/unmaintained="yes" univention-install gdb libc6-dbg libvirt0-dbg python2.4-dbg ucr set repository/online/unmaintained="$oldstate"[/li]
[li] Abgelen des angehängten Scripts auf dem System.[/li][/ul]

Wenn das Problem erneut auftritt, können Sie durch den folgenden Aufruf Backtraces erzeugen die Sie bitte, zusammen mit der Ausgabe des Befehls “dpkg -l” an uns senden:

./uvmmd-gdb.sh $(pgrep -f /usr/sbin/univention-virtual-machine-manager-daemon)

Mit freundlichen Grüßen
Janis Meybohm
uvmmd-gdb.sh (1.32 KB)

Mastodon